William Burell Jr., age 55 of Dayton, passed away Tuesday, September 18, 2018 at Hospice of Dayton. He was born February 9, 1963 in Dayton, Ohio the son of William and Betty (Logan) Burell Sr.

In addition to his parents he was preceded in death by siblings, Thomas E. Logan and Katherine F. Burell.
Billy is survived by his husband, W. C. James Burell; his son, William Burell, III; siblings, Geraldine Burell, Joan Burell, Bettie Jean Burell; numerous nieces and nephews; sister-in-law, Pearl Valentine; and many friends.

Billy was a 1982 graduate of Belmont High School and attended some classes at Sinclair Community College. He has enjoyed a 20-year career in parking services for University of Dayton where he was known as the “Gate Keeper”. He loved to garden and domestic work always keeping an immaculate home. Billy also had an appreciation for art, keeping in shape and following his favorite athletes and sports teams.

Family is hosting a celebration of life 1:00pm Friday, September 28, 2018 at Woodland Cemetery - Mausoleum Chapel, Dayton. Memorial contributions may be made to Hospice of Dayton at 324 Wilmington Ave., Dayton OH 45420.
